There are many ways to cook sweet potatoes, and one of the easiest is in the microwave. How long to cook sweet potato in the microwave will depend on the size of the potato and the power of the microwave.
Generally, small sweet potatoes will cook in 5-7 minutes, while medium sweet potatoes will take 8-10 minutes, and large sweet potatoes will take 11-13 minutes.
To cook a sweet potato in the microwave, first wash it and dry it off. Pierce the potato several times with a fork, then place it on a microwavable plate.
cook the sweet potato on high power for the required amount of time. You can tell it is done when it is soft all the way through.
Serve the sweet potato with butter, brown sugar, cinnamon, or your favorite toppings. It is a healthy and delicious side dish for any meal.

Selecting the Right Sweet Potato for Microwave Cooking
When it comes to cooking sweet potatoes in the microwave, there are a few things to consider. The first is the variety of sweet potato you are using. There are two main types of sweet potatoes: the moist, orange-fleshed sweet potatoes, and the drier, white-fleshed sweet potatoes. The orange-fleshed sweet potatoes are better suited for microwave cooking, as they are moister and less likely to dry out.
The next consideration is the size of the sweet potato. Smaller sweet potatoes will cook more quickly than larger ones. If you are cooking more than one sweet potato, be s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ly.
Finally, you will need to pierce the sweet potato several times with a fork before cooking. This will allow the steam to escape and prevent the sweet potato from bursting.

Determining the Recommended Cooking Time
When it comes to cooking sweet potatoes, there is no one-size-fits-all answer. The cooking time will depend on the size and variety of sweet potato, as well as the power of your microwave.
A good rule of thumb is to start with 5 minutes per sweet potato, then adjust as necessary. Larger sweet potatoes may need up to 10 minutes, while smaller potatoes may only need 3-4 minutes.
To test for doneness, pierce the sweet potato with a fork. The potato is done when the fork slides in easily.
If the sweet potato is not done after the first round of cooking, you can continue cooking it in 1-minute increments until it issoft enough to pierce with a fork.
